Tests hang if run with partial environment

Bug #887885 reported by Gabriel Hurley
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Dashboard (Horizon)
Fix Released
High
Gabriel Hurley

Bug Description

If buildout fails to complete (often caused by pypi problems), particularly during an initial run of ./run_tests.sh, it causes the script to hang waiting for selenium to start despite the fact that it's not installed.

Devin Carlen (devcamcar)
Changed in horizon:
status: New → Confirmed
importance: Undecided → High
milestone: none → essex-1
assignee: nobody → Gabriel Hurley (gabriel-hurley)
Revision history for this message
Openstack Gerrit (openstack-gerrit) wrote : Fix merged to horizon (master)

Reviewed: https://review.openstack.org/1475
Committed: http://github.com/openstack/horizon/commit/34e217b357457eadec9cc668b722fa7fd3f43ee9
Submitter: Jenkins
Branch: master

 status fixcommitted
 done

commit 34e217b357457eadec9cc668b722fa7fd3f43ee9
Author: Gabriel Hurley <email address hidden>
Date: Wed Nov 9 12:32:54 2011 -0800

    Added sanity checks and environment versioning to run_tests.sh.

    Implements blueprint environment-versioning.

    Fixed bug 887885. The script will bail if the seleniumrc or test scripts are missing, preventing the hang, or the possibility of bad environments.

    Change-Id: I3cdeb71660c897e8b2adbf81d3794333d1847204

Changed in horizon:
status: Confirmed → Fix Committed
Revision history for this message
Thierry Carrez (ttx) wrote :

This was not committed to essex-1 milestone-proposed, only on essex-2 master.

Changed in horizon:
status: Fix Committed → In Progress
Revision history for this message
Thierry Carrez (ttx) wrote :

I just re-branched milestone-proposed from current master state, since master had not diverged except with that commit.
In the future, please do not set to FixCommitted and tag essex-1 until it's fixed in milestone-proposed...

Changed in horizon:
status: In Progress → Fix Committed
Thierry Carrez (ttx)
Changed in horizon:
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in horizon:
milestone: essex-1 → 2012.1
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.